Thanks. Can you please also do
sudo killall devkit-power-daemon ; sudo /usr/lib/devicekit-power/devkit-
power-daemon -v 2>&1 | tee /tmp/dkp.log
then wait a bit (~ 30 seconds), pull out AC cable, wait some more, plug
it back in, wait again, and then press Control-C. Please attach
/tmp/dkp.log here
